Q: Is 501,235 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 501,235 is not a prime number.

Why is 501,235 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 501235 can be evenly divided by 1 5 7 35 14,321 71,605 100,247 and 501,235, with no remainder.

Since 501,235 cannot be divided by just 1 and 501,235, it is not a prime number.
